Want food that fuels your day without drama? Swap one habit at a time. Small changes beat big rules—so start with what you actually will do tomorrow morning.
First practical switch: fix breakfast. A meal with protein, fiber, and some healthy fat helps steady energy and cuts mid-morning cravings. Try Greek yogurt with berries and a sprinkle of oats, or scrambled eggs with spinach and a slice of whole-grain toast. If you're on the go, blend a quick health juice with spinach, banana, and a scoop of protein—great after a workout.
Healthy snacks keep your energy steady and prevent overeating later. Choose snacks that pair carbs with protein or fat—apple slices with almond butter, hummus and carrot sticks, or a small handful of nuts and an orange. Swap sugary bars for homemade energy bites made from oats, nut butter, and dates. These simple swaps give you steady blood sugar and less guilt.
Meal prep saves time and stress. Cook a large batch of grains, roast a tray of veggies, and portion out a protein so you can assemble meals in minutes. Use glass containers so meals stay visible in the fridge—if you see it, you’ll eat it.
Your gut affects sleep, mood, and strength. Add fiber gradually: aim for 25–30 g a day from fruits, vegetables, beans, and whole grains. Include fermented foods like yogurt, kefir, or sauerkraut a few times a week to support the microbiome. If bloating is an issue, try cutting back on common triggers one at a time—wheat, high-FODMAP fruits, or dairy—and track changes for a week.
Hydration matters. Drinking water before meals can reduce overeating and help digestion. If plain water is boring, infuse it with lemon, cucumber, or mint. After exercise, a vegetable-forward juice with a touch of fruit helps with rehydration and muscle recovery.
Feeding kids? Keep it fun and consistent. Offer the same healthy choice in different formats: oatmeal bars, mini frittatas, or fruit kabobs. Short, tasty breakfasts and snacks set habits that stick.
Mindful eating beats strict diets. Pause for three breaths before a meal, chew slowly, and notice hunger signals. You’ll eat less and enjoy food more. When you slip up, move on—one meal won’t ruin progress, but repeated restriction will.
